In addition, the successful candidate will be organized and take initiative, able to develop strong relationships with clients, prospects, teammates, and internal/external distribution partners. Good analytical skills and experience conducting GRS marketings, request for proposals, and finalist presentations are important competencies for these roles.Managing Consultants are the day-to-day contact for clients assigned and will typically work together with a Consultant on large/complex clients. The main difference between the Consultant role and Managing Consultant role is the Consultant role has business development responsibilities.The Managing Consultant (GRS) WillClient Service: Manage and service an existing block of GRS clients through proactive account management and regular client contact with the support of 1-2 others depending on the size/complexity of the client. Maintain a client database of key information and keep up to date. Performance is measured by client retention/satisfaction levels and adherence to quality of client records and database maintenance.Development of Others: Coach and Mentor others on the team to help with their development and career progression which will help the practice and you personally to be able to take on more clients as your block expands. Performance is measured by team feedback and their personal development and progress.Special Projects: Support the GRS practice by helping with client communication summaries of key legislation updates and CAPSA guideline updates. Participate in and or host webinars and member information sessions. Other projects as assigned.Subject Matter Expert: Maintain LLQP license, monitor competitive landscape on market trends, pricing, products, and services.
